OK, back to the topic...

My wife had just given me a no guard buzz before I left town for a few days to take care of some business. 

She had been cutting my hair for years, and it kept getting shorter and shorter, but never went beyond the shortest setting on the clippers.  I mentioned to her a few times that we should "finish the job", but she said that she didn't think she would like it.  So, on this trip, I got out the razor and gel, got into the shower and shaved my head.  When I told her on the phone about it, she was a little bit miffed, and let me know about it. 

IMHO, my hair had been so short for so long, that taking off the last 1/16th of an inch wasn't that much difference. 

When we got back together a few days later, she looked me up and down, and said, "I guess it doesn't look THAT bad..." 

Since then, her comments have been rather limited.  She likes to rub my head, and she notices and comments when I miss a shave.  If someone else asks, "Why does he shave his head like that?", she replies, "Because he likes to."

In all, it just has not been an issue for her, one way or the other.
